Turn any Google Docs template into a dynamic PDF generation engine. Create one template, generate thousands of perfectly-formatted PDFs with unique data. Perfect for businesses needing to scale document production while maintaining brand consistency.

Key Features:

  • Generate unlimited PDFs from a single Google Docs template
  • 100% formatting preservation from Google Docs to PDF
  • Support for dynamic content:
    • Text variables using {{variable}} syntax
    • Image placeholders with automatic injection (Image->Image)
    • Inline Image injection (Text->Image)
    • Smart tables that automatically expand based on your data
    • Conditional rendering of content based on a simple #if:x#...#endif:x# syntax
  • Bulk generation via Excel uploads, Google Sheets or API integration
  • Webhook support for workflow integration

Whether you're generating contracts, certificates, invoices, or reports, Doxy maintains pixel-perfect formatting while allowing you to inject custom data for each document. No more manual editing, lengthy conversion chains, or formatting fixes.

What's the story behind your product?

Doxy.ink's answer

Doxy was born from a real-world challenge: the need to generate beautiful, legally-required documents at scale while maintaining perfect formatting.

As a lead developer, I initially tried traditional approaches: * HTML templates with wkhtml2pdf * Converting Google Docs to HTML * Working with DOCX files * Using third-party conversion APIs

Each solution fell short, either producing poor results or being prohibitively expensive. The breakthrough came when we realized Google's own PDF conversion API could maintain the exact formatting we needed. The challenge was figuring out how to properly inject dynamic data, especially for tables with varying rows.

After solving these technical challenges for our own business needs, it became clear that many other companies face the same problem: they need to generate professional documents at scale while maintaining the design quality of their Google Docs templates.

This realization led to the creation of Doxy - a platform that bridges the gap between beautiful Google Docs templates and automated PDF generation. We've solved the hard technical problems so other businesses don't have to, making it simple to generate perfectly formatted documents at scale.

Today, Doxy helps businesses automate their document generation while maintaining the exact formatting of their Google Docs templates, whether they're creating contracts, proposals, certificates, or any other professional document that needs to be personalized at scale.

Which are the primary technologies used for building your product?

Doxy.ink's answer

Backend: - Node.js with NestJS framework - TypeScript for type safety - PostgreSQL for data storage - TypeORM for database management

Frontend: - React.js - Material-UI (MUI) for component design - Redux for state management

Cloud Infrastructure: - Google Cloud Platform - Cloud Functions for document processing - Cloud Storage for document storage - PubSub for event handling

Core APIs: - Google Docs API for template manipulation - Google Drive API for file management and PDF conversion
